LsAA9A and CvAA9A digestion products of MLG suggest preference for Cell4 region cleavage. Products of LsAA9A (a) and CvAA9A (b) activity on barley MLG with 4 mM ascorbate were analysed by MALDI-ToF MS (performed in triplicate). Both enzymes can produce both C1 and C4 oxidation on MLG (1,4-ox; oxidized C1 and C4, see insets). Further, oligosaccharide profiles show a distinct pattern indicative of the mechanism of attack and substrate specificity of each enzyme on MLG. c Proposed region of cleavage
